
Earlier today, the Los Angeles Fire Department (LAFD) addressed a small brush fire in Ernest Debs Regional Park at Montecito Heights. As reported at 10:24 AM, the fire originated from an unattended makeshift fire pit near the Walnut Forest Trail and Seco Valle Trail, as per an LAFD report.
There was no wind, so the fire posed no threat to nearby structures or communities.
Arriving at the location within 20 minutes, LAFD crews contained the fire swiftly. A follow-up report by the LAFD confirmed containment and extinguishment before it could spread to nearby brush. The incident caused no injuries or evacuation requirements.
